TOP SECRET (2) Agreed to take note of the views expressed in discussion by the Committee on the dangers of accepting students on United Kingdom courses of instruction who had been selected on account of their possible anti-British outlook with the object of being converted on these courses, unless such a policy should be previously discussed and approved. 2. CEYLON CENSUS. SECRET THE COMMITTEE had before them a minute+ by the Secretary covering a minute from the Air Ministry on the subject of the forthcoming census in Ceylon.
